Got in my car yesterday morning and it barely cranked, wouldn't start. I was still on the OEM battery so I was expecting it to happen pretty soon. I wanted to get something decent that would last as long as the original Panasonic did. Locally I have Advance Auto, Fisher Auto Parts, and NAPA. I don't like Advance electrical parts, not sure what sort of batteries Fisher carries. NAPA was the closest place I thought I could get a quality battery. However, their website and local computer system doesn't know that a Mazdaspeed3 exists, and Google searches didn't help either. So I brought my old battery in and put it on the counter and asked for a battery of the same size.

I can report NAPA Legend 75 month battery #7535 fits just fine. It was $104 and hopefully will last the 6+ years it's supposed to.

After all that I notice I had left one of the overhead map lights on. That's ok, I had noticed the car was cranking slower for several months, like if it didn't start the first try it might not start. But I could have gotten even more life out of the OEM.
